在Oracle数据库中,如果你不小心删除了某些重要的数据,你可以尝试使用以下方法来恢复它们:
使用回收站:
SELECT * FROM recyclebin;
RESTORE
命令。例如,要恢复名为my_table
的表,你可以使用:RESTORE TABLE my_table FROM RECYCLEBIN;
使用Flashback工具:
my_table
的表到某个时间点,你可以使用:FLASHBACK TABLE my_table TO TIMESTAMP 'YYYY-MM-DD HH24:MI:SS';
使用RMAN(恢复管理器):
从应用程序日志或其他来源中恢复:
专业数据恢复服务:
请注意,预防总是比恢复更重要。定期备份你的数据、限制对重要数据的访问、以及定期审查你的数据库和应用程序逻辑都是减少数据丢失风险的有效方法。
亿速云「云数据库 MySQL」免部署即开即用,比自行安装部署数据库高出1倍以上的性能,双节点冗余防止单节点故障,数据自动定期备份随时恢复。点击查看>>
推荐阅读:sqlserver误删数据库如何恢复